 --Validating ability to deliver service management and triple play services--

Dallas, TX and Redwood City, CA, May 22, 2006 - ZTE Corporation, a leading global provider of telecommunications equipment and network solutions, and SupportSoft, Inc. (Nasdaq: SPRT), a leading provider of Real-Time Service Management (RTSM™) software, have successfully completed interoperability testing at SupportSoft´s Digital 360° Interoperability Lab of ZTE´s Home Gateway devices according to the TR-069 DSL Forum CPE WAN Management protocol.

The testing validates the interoperability of ZTE´s H110/H100 Home Gateway devices with SupportSoft ServiceGateway™ software to deliver triple play services and service management.

"Demonstrating ZTE´s interoperability with SupportSoft solutions and the TR-069 specifications offers service providers reassurance that ZTE´s Home Gateway products are capable of being integrated into their customer-oriented TR-069 based management framework," said Jiming Liu, vice president of engineering, ZTE USA. 

The TR-069 specification provides the necessary framework for efficient and scalable deployment of new services using DSL broadband infrastructure, including the combined delivery of VoIP, IPTV and high-speed data services.

Interoperability according to the TR-069 DSL Forum protocol ensures that equipment such as ZTE´s Home Gateway products can be easily configured, activated and managed from a network console with software solutions such as SupportSoft´s ServiceGateway; thereby helping service providers to control the costs of deployment, support home gateway devices and tightly manage triple play service delivery.
